Job description

Job Description:-

The CMMs will be responsible for implementing the programme at the grassroots level in the ULB with the following key functions:

Scheme Implementation: Ensure effective and timely implementation of the scheme in the concerned ULB and supervise the performance of RPs.

Support to Municipal Leadership: Assist the Municipal Commissioner/Executive Officer in operationalizing, monitoring, and reviewing various components of the scheme.

Stakeholder Coordination: Coordinate with key stakeholders including Resource Persons and facilitate linkages with schemes under SVANidhi Se Samriddhi at the ULB Level.

 Information, Education & Communication (IEC): Plan and implement IEC activities to raise awareness and improve outreach of the scheme among stakeholders and beneficiaries.

Capacity Building & Partnerships: Manage and implement various capacity building activities for ULBs/district officials, resource persons, street vendors etc.

\Fund Monitoring: Monitor scheme finances at the ULB level.

\ Data Management: Ensure timely and accurate updating of beneficiary and scheme-related data on the MIS portal.

Additional Duties: Any other responsibility or task as assigned by the State/UT/ULB in line with overall mission framework
